Which graph represents the function f(x)=(x-5)^2+3

We have been given a function formula f(x)=(x-5)^2+3. We are asked to graph the given function.

We know that standard form of parabola is in format y=a(x-h)^2+k, where, (h,k) represents the vertex of parabola.

Upon looking at our given formula, we can see that it represents an upward opening parabola as leading coefficient is positive. The vertex of our given parabola will be at point (5,3).

We are given that a function

f(x)=(x-5)^2+3

The given function is an equation of parabola along y- axis.

General equation of parabola along y- axis  with vertex (h,k) is given by

(y-k)=(x-h)^2

y=(x-h)^2+k

Compare it with given equation then we get

h=5, k=3

Vertex of given parabola =(5,3)

Substitute x=0 then we get

f(0)=(0-5)^2+3=28

y-intercept of parabola is at (0,28).
